Samsung Galaxy A50 (6GB RAM + 64GB) vs Xiaomi Redmi Note 7 (6GB RAM + 64GB)
Here you can compare Samsung Galaxy A50 (6GB RAM + 64GB) and Xiaomi Redmi Note 7 (6GB RAM + 64GB). Comparing Samsung Galaxy A50 (6GB RAM + 64GB) vs Xiaomi Redmi Note 7 (6GB RAM + 64GB) on Smartprix enables you to check their respective specs scores and unique features. It would potentially help you understand how Samsung Galaxy A50 (6GB RAM + 64GB) stands against Xiaomi Redmi Note 7 (6GB RAM + 64GB) and which one should you buy The current lowest price found for Samsung Galaxy A50 (6GB RAM + 64GB) is ₹15,990 and for Xiaomi Redmi Note 7 (6GB RAM + 64GB) is ₹14,333. The details of both of these products were last updated on Mar 22, 2024.
Specification | Samsung Galaxy A50 (6GB RAM + 64GB) | Xiaomi Redmi Note 7 (6GB RAM + 64GB) |
---|---|---|
Battery | 4000 mAh, Li-Po Battery | 4000 mAh, Li-ion Battery |
Internal Memory | 64 GB | 64 GB |
CPU | 2.3 GHz, Octa Core Processor | 2.2 GHz, Octa Core Processor |
Display | 6.4 inches, 1080 x 2340 pixels | 6.3 inches, 2340 x 1080 pixels |
OS | Android v9.0 (Pie), upgradable to v11 | Android v9.0 (Pie) |
Price | ₹15,990 | ₹14,333 |

Camera
Rear Camera | 25 MP f/1.7 8 MP f/2.2 5 MP f/2.2 with autofocus | 48 MP f/1.8 5 MP f/2.4 with autofocus |
Features | Panorama, HDR | AI-enabled Dual Camera, Portrait Mode, Face detection, Touch to focus |
Video Recording | 1080p @ 30 fps FHD | 1080p @ 30 fps FHD |
Flash | Yes, LED | Yes, LED |
Front Camera | 25 MP f/2 | 13 MP |
Technical
OS | Android v9.0 (Pie), upgradable to v11 | Android v9.0 (Pie) |
Chipset | Samsung Exynos 9610 | Qualcomm Snapdragon 660 |
CPU | 2.3 GHz, Octa Core Processor | 2.2 GHz, Octa Core Processor |
GPU | Mali-G72 MP3 | Adreno 512 |
Java | Yes | Yes, via 3rd party |
Browser | Yes, supports HTML5 | Yes, supports HTML5 |
